By the time of the Civil War, cotton constituted nearly _____ of the total export trade of the United States: a) 10% b) 25% c) 50% d) 75%

Answer: C

Explanation: That five hundred million pounds of cotton made up nearly 55 percent of the entire United States export market, a trend that continued nearly every year until the outbreak of the Civil War. So C is the closest.
